Embracing AI for Enhanced Software Testing

The advent of artificial intelligence (AI) in the realm of software development is reshaping the landscape, particularly through its application in code testing. This transformation has been highlighted by the rapid valuation growth seen at Blacksmith, an AI code-testing startup that experienced a near-decade jump in its worth over a short period.

The technology behind this trend involves AI systems that can analyze and test software code more efficiently than traditional methods. By leveraging machine learning algorithms, these AI tools can identify bugs, optimize performance, and ensure compliance with coding standards at an unprecedented scale. This not only accelerates the development process but also enhances the quality of the final product.

AI in Software Validation: A Game-Changer

The core innovation lies in how AI automates the validation phase of software development, which is traditionally a labor-intensive and time-consuming process. With AI, developers can run extensive tests with minimal human intervention, allowing for faster iteration cycles and quicker release times. This capability is especially crucial in industries where rapid updates are essential, such as technology startups operating in highly competitive markets.

Blacksmith’s success story underscores the potential of AI in transforming not just code testing but the broader software development lifecycle. Its valuation jump from a multi-million dollar funding round to nearly 550 million dollars demonstrates the market’s recognition of this disruptive technology and its applications beyond simple testing. This growth indicates that AI can drive significant value by streamlining complex processes and reducing costs.

Practical Recommendations

To effectively implement AI in software development and validation processes, organizations should start by defining clear objectives that align with their business goals. A generic records-digitisation client might focus on reducing document management costs and improving data accuracy. Identifying these specific targets will help in selecting the right AI tools and technologies. Additionally, it’s crucial to establish a robust testing framework early on to ensure that the AI systems perform as expected. For instance, setting up a pilot project can allow for thorough testing of the system's capabilities before full-scale implementation.

Another practical step is to invest in training and support for the team responsible for integrating and maintaining these AI systems. A custom-software client faced challenges due to a lack of knowledge about how to best utilize their new platform, leading to underutilization and inefficiencies. Providing comprehensive training sessions and ongoing support can help overcome this hurdle. Furthermore, organizations should consider setting up dedicated roles within the team, such as an AI specialist or data scientist, to oversee the deployment and maintenance of these systems. This ensures that there is always expertise available to address any issues that may arise.
